Left-Turn Lane to Be Installed at Cherry, Marshall Streets in Winston-Salem

WINSTON-SALEM – A new left-turn lane is being installed in downtown Winston-Salem at the corner of Eighth and Marshall streets.
 
As a result, the N.C. Department of Transportation will close a small portion of Eighth Street between Cherry and Marshall streets starting at 7 a.m. Saturday. The work also requires that the left-turn lane from Marshall Street onto Eighth Street be closed, as this portion of Eighth Street is already closed.
 
This closure will last until Nov. 9. However, if the work is completed sooner, the road will open earlier.
 
The detour around this section of work, which includes Eighth Street and North MLK Jr. Drive is to use Seventh Street, Liberty Street and Main Street.
 
Liberty Street and Main Street are both one-way streets, so the direction you are traveling will dictate which one you use.
 
Currently, there is one left-turn lane from Marshall Street to Eighth Street. During this closure of the small portion of Eighth Street, NCDOT will be constructing a second left-turn lane along Marshall Street and add a lane to Eighth Street.  
 
As a result, there will be two left-turn lanes from Marshall Street to Eighth Street.
